Canadian banks will not give residential customers access to direct connect. We are forced to use Web Connect. It means I have to down load each bank account or credit card separately save the file and import to money dance. I have one site that only allows to download a .csv file. I then run a conversion add on, in Excel which gives me a .qif file. The I save the .qif file. Then import the file into money dance. Needles to say money dance in my case is not as user friendly as I would like it to be but whit I like about money dance is that it does not store my banking usermame and password in the cloud like quicken does.</p></div>rsmerrintag:infinitekind.tenderapp.com,2009-01-14:Comment/467356592019-01-01T21:25:36Z2019-01-01T21:25:36ZMoneydance 2019<div><p>Web Connect is a proprietary Quicken technology so TIK cannot just use it.</p>
<p>To use Web Connect they would likely have to pay Quicken licensing fees and that does not make good business sense, hence TIK need to look at developing something to interact with the banks Web site so that they can achieve an outcome similar to Web Connect and that is what we are starting to see the foundation of in MD2019.</p>
